Default Dual QTP Cutouts

is anyone running dual QTP cutouts before the cats on a Y-pipe car, i like the idea of having the cutout or cutouts before the cats, noise inside the car dosent bother me because i can close them and it wont be that bad

With factory manifolds its not possible to run cutouts before the cats. A single 3" cutout in the intermediate pipe is all you need. Your gonna love it. Had my qtp cutout for a long as i can remember.
